Issue 3: SoCal Residents Not as Trusting as Rest of Nation

Abstract

SCS Fact Sheet no. 3 looks at levels of trust in Southern California. Overall, Southern California residents are not as trusting as Americans in general. On an individual level, trust is related to one’s opinions and behavior. And finally, higher levels of income and education increase levels of trust, as does being white and being older.
